The companies activities have benefited the community by hosting fitness classes for children of all ages and gender. Teaching over 100 kids weekly. The company charges 50% of what other similar businesses do in the local area. And has paid over £6000 to a local community centre to rent the space allowing more activities to be put on as well as doing up the building.
No consultation with stakeholders
Directors salary £4884
No transfer of assets other than for full consideration
